datasheetbank_Logo
Integrated circuits, Transistor, Semiconductors Search and Datasheet PDF Download Site

STA015 View Datasheet(PDF) - STMicroelectronics

Part Name
Description
View to exact match
STA015 Datasheet PDF : 44 Pages
1 2 3 4 5 6 7 8 9 10 Next Last
STA015-STA015B-STA015T
In this mode the fractional part of the PLL is dis-
abled and the audio clocks are generated at
nominal rates. Fig. 6 describes the default
DATA_REQ signal behaviour. Programming
STA015 it is possible to invert the polarity of the
DATA_REQ line (register REQ_POL).
In order to allow proper operation of the device in
broadcast applications a special BRAODCAST
MP3 decoding mode is available. When config-
ured in BROADCAST mode the device will oper-
ate as a slave decoder and no more feedback will
be generated to the data source. The output PCM
clock will be automatically adjusted by the em-
bedded DSP in order to follow the incoming bit-
stream rate and to avoid input buffer under-
run/overrun. A special configuration file must be
used to enable this operational mode: the file
must be downloaded via I2C link after device
power-on. Please contact your local ST branch to
have more information about.
Figure 6. DATA_REQ control line
coding states are described in the STA015 I2C
registers description.
Idle Mode
In this mode (entered after a S/W or H/W reset)
the decoder is waiting for the RUN command.
This mode should be used to initialize the con-
figuration registers of the device. The DAC con-
nected to STA015 can be initialized during this
mode (set MUTE to 1).
PLAY
X
X
MUTE
0
1
Clock State PCM Output
Not Running
0
Running
0
Init Mode
"PLAY" and "MUTE" changes are ignored in this
mode. The internal state of the decoder will be
updated only when the decoder changes from the
state "init" to the state "decode". The "init" phase
ends when the first decoded samples are at the
output stage of the device.
SOURCE STOPS TRANSMITTING DATA
SOURCE STOPS TRANSMITTING DATA
DATA_REQ
SOURCE SEND DATA TO STA015
D00AU1144
2.4 - STA015 Decoding States
There are three different decoder states: Idle,
Init, and Decode. Commands to change the de-
Figure 7. MPEG Decoder Interfaces.
Decode Mode
This mode is completely described by the follow-
ing table:
PLAY
0
0
1
1
MUTE
0
1
0
1
Clock State
PCM
Output
Decoding
Not Running 0
No
Running
0
No
Running Decoded Yes
Samples
Running
0
Yes
DATA
SOURCE
DATA_REQ
SDI
SCKR
BIT_EN
ยตP
XTI XTO FILT
IIC
SCL
SDA
PLL
IIC
MPEG
DECODER
SERIAL AUDIO INTERFACE
RX
TX
SDO
SCKT
LRCKT
DAC
D98AU912
OCLK
9/44
 

Share Link: 

datasheetbank.com [ Privacy Policy ] [ Request Datasheet ] [ Contact Us ]